Java初识1. 下载JDK2. 编写第一个java程序3. IDE介绍(IntelliJ IDEA)4. 总结 1. 下载JDK官方下载网址:https://www.java.com/zh-CN/ 下载后直接双击安装完成即可,需要注意的是安装的目录需要记住,后面需要设置环境变量。那怎么知道java已经安装成功了呢,在cmd命令行中输入java -version看看是否有输出java版本号,如果
转载 2023-08-31 12:05:14
480阅读
 首先我们要了解什么是java?一个 Java 程序可以认为是一系列对象的集合,而这些对象通过调用彼此的方法来协同工作。下面简要介绍下Java的几个结构:类、对象、方法和变量。对象:对象是类的一个实例,有状态和行为。例如,一条狗是一个对象,它的状态有:颜色、名字、品种;行为有:摇尾巴、叫、吃等。类:类是一个模板,它描述一类对象的行为和状态。方法:方法就是行为,一个类可以有很多方法。逻辑运
对象的初始化(1) 非静态对象的初始化在创建对象时,对象所在类的所有数据成员会首先进行初始化。基本类型:int型,初始化为0。如果为对象:这些对象会按顺序初始化。※在所有类成员初始化完成之后,才调用本类的构造方法创建对象。构造方法的作用就是初始化。(2) 静态对象的初始化程序中主类的静态变量会在main方法执行前初始化。不仅第一次创建对象时,类中的所有静态变量都初始化,并且第一次访问某类(注意此时
Java快速入门:Java修饰符类型修饰符是一种添加到定义以更改其含义的关键字。Java语言有各种各样的修饰符,包括以下两种 - Java访问修饰符 - 例如:private,protected,public等。 Java非访问修饰符 - 例如:static,final等。 要使用修饰符,请在类,方法或变量的定义中包含修饰符关键字。一文解析Java的对象下面将深入了解什么是对象。 如果考虑现实世界
转载 2024-06-12 12:22:15
38阅读
 Java的异常(包括Exception和Error)分为 :可查的异常(checked exceptions)和不可查的异常(unchecked exceptions) 。         可查异常(编译器要求必须处置的异常):      除了RuntimeException及
标题:7种方法查询Windows系统信息描述:在Windows中,有多种方法可以了解系统的详细信息。本文将介绍7种常见的方法来查询Windows系统信息。正文:作为Windows用户,我们通常需要了解我们正在使用的计算机的配置和性能数据。这里提供了7种快捷方法来查询Windows系统信息。使用systeminfo命令systeminfo命令显示有关操作系统的详细信息,如安装日期、OS版本、安全更新
转载 2023-07-28 22:33:49
130阅读
# WorkBeach的架构设计探讨 ## 引言 在现代软件开发中,架构设计扮演着至关重要的角色。好的架构不仅能提高系统的可维护性和可扩展性,还能在团队的协作中产生积极的影响。WorkBeach作为一种在线协作工具,其架构设计吸纳了众多优良实践与设计思想,助力团队高效协作。在本文中,我们将探讨WorkBeach在架构设计方面的理念、具体实现以及代码示例。 ## WorkBeach架构设计的核心
原创 2024-09-27 04:57:48
29阅读
有师傅教我学习juniper防火墙吗?
转载 2011-07-18 12:02:55
1180阅读
空调知识定频空调和变频空调定频空调:达到设定的温度后,空调就会停止运转。变频空调:达到调节的温度后,空调保持低频运转。什么是匹数?空调的匹数:匹数是功率单位,空调的匹数指的是空调的输入功率,1匹=735W。那2匹就是1470W,1.5匹就是1100W。如果是1300W或者1400W呢,这时候不到2匹,一般称为小2匹。同理,大1匹也是这个意思。匹数和制冷量什么关系?我们前面提到匹数只是输入功率,但实
转载 2023-08-13 21:30:14
367阅读
基础步骤1、准备工作- 1.查看已有镜像 | docker images | docker images -aq // 已经是查看本地镜像,-aq查所有的id — 2.查启动过的容器 | docker ps // 查看启动中的容器,没有 | docker ps -a // 查看历史启动的容器,没有2、查找镜像docker search 镜像名
转载 2024-03-18 10:31:40
258阅读
roku能不能安装软件 Twitch is the premier platform for watching esports tournaments, industry events, and gaming personalities. Amazon pulled the official app from Roku Channel Store in 2017,
转载 2024-04-10 14:01:30
81阅读
# Java 并发编程的探讨与解决方案 在现代软件开发中,随着多核处理器的广泛应用,如何有效地利用并发编程显得尤为重要。Java语言为我们提供了强大的并发支持,能够轻松地处理多线程任务。本文将通过一个具体的示例来阐述如何通过Java实现并发,将问题背景、解决方案、代码示例以及类图和甘特图结合起来。 ## 1. 问题背景 假设我们需要从多个数据源收集数据并进行处理。假如这些数据源是通过网络接口
原创 2024-10-22 06:11:12
14阅读
# 怎么看JAVA位置 ## 简介 在Java中,位置可以指代多个含义。一方面,位置可以表示代码中的行号和文件路径,用于定位和调试代码。另一方面,位置也可以表示在Java程序中的对象的位置,包括堆内存和栈内存中的位置。 本文将从两个方面来解析和讨论Java中的位置。 ## 代码位置 在Java中,可以通过异常堆栈来获取代码位置的信息。当程序抛出异常时,异常堆栈会被记录下来,其中包含了引发
原创 2023-09-09 06:38:15
66阅读
在处理 Java Web 应用程序时,了解如何查看 `contextPath` 是极其重要的。`contextPath` 在 Java Servlet 和 JSP 中是指应用的上下文路径。它通常用来帮助区分不同的 web 应用。例如,在一个 web 服务器上,可能同时运行多个应用,而 `contextPath` 能让我们轻松访问特定的应用。下面我将详细探讨如何查看 `contextPath`,并且
原创 7月前
94阅读
# Java日志怎么看 在开发Java应用程序时,日志是一种非常重要的工具,用于记录应用程序的运行状态、错误信息和调试信息。Java提供了一套强大的日志框架,可以帮助开发人员记录和管理日志。本文将介绍如何使用Java的日志框架来记录和查看日志。 ## 1. 日志框架介绍 Java提供了多个日志框架,其中最常用的是java.util.logging、log4j和logback。这些框架都提供了
原创 2023-12-09 07:05:39
82阅读
# 如何查看Java对象的内存地址 在Java中,理解对象的内存地址虽然不是一项常见的需求,但在调试、性能优化或者对比Java与其他语言(如C/C++)的内存管理机制时,这一点是非常重要的。本文将探讨如何查看Java对象的内存地址,并提供一个项目方案来实现这一目标。 ## 项目背景 Java是一种高级编程语言,具有自动内存管理(垃圾回收)的特性。这导致我们无法直接访问对象的内存地址。但我们可
原创 2024-08-26 06:51:05
40阅读
# Java API怎么看 ## 背景 Java API是Java编程语言提供的一组类和接口,用于开发Java应用程序。它提供了丰富的功能和工具,可以帮助开发人员更轻松地构建各种应用。然而,对于初学者来说,熟悉和理解Java API可能是一个困难的过程。本文将介绍一种方案,帮助初学者更好地理解和使用Java API。 ## 方案 ### 步骤1:选择合适的API文档 Java API有许
原创 2023-08-06 18:51:04
103阅读
1评论
# 如何 Java 的 JVM Java 虚拟机(JVM)是 Java 程序的关键组件,它负责将 Java 字节码翻译成操作系统能够理解的机器码。理解 JVM 可以帮助我们更好地优化 Java 程序的性能,解决可能出现的问题。下面我们将讨论如何查看 JVM 的运行情况以及如何分析 JVM 的性能。 ## 如何查看 JVM 的运行情况 我们可以使用 `jstat` 命令来查看 JVM 的运行
原创 2024-05-30 04:28:03
64阅读
1.MAT简介:jvm内存溢出/内存泄漏问题分析定位神器MAT 全称 Eclipse Memory Analysis Tools 是一个分析 Java堆数据的专业工具,可以计算出内存中对象的实例数量、占用空间大小、引用关系等,看看是谁阻止了垃圾收集器的回收工作,从而定位内存泄漏的原因。2.什么时候会用到MAT?a)OutOfMemoryError的时候,触发Full GC,但空间却回收不
2.3Java命令行工具2.3.1编译运行       到了这里,是不是开始膨胀了,想写一段代码来秀一下?好吧,满足你!国际惯例,我们写一段HelloWorld。我们在某个目录下记事本,编写一段代码如下:保存为“HelloWorld.java”。然后呢?傻了吧,不知道该怎么办了?哈哈!别急,回忆一下java的工作原理,第一步是不是需要编译
  • 1
  • 2
  • 3
  • 4
  • 5